BALTIC DRY INDEX CONTINUALLY DIPPED IN RED
COALspot.com: The Baltic Dry Index continues its decline and fell 5.18 pct to 530 points week on week due to falling commodity prices and declining import demand from China and particularly celebrations of Lunar New Year holidays next week. Most of the owners are hoping that the market would pick up after the Lunar New Year holidays and will have to wait to see how the market behaves.
In recent months, the dry bulk shipping industry is affected by numerous factors such as world economies’ slow growth and weak commodity demand. China’s economic growth rate impact dry bulk shipper’s movement as China is an important commodity market, which is the backbone of growth of shipping industry recent years. According to industry analysts, the world’s fleet of dry-bulk ships are far exceeding demand and estimated around 20% above demand over the past few years. Recovery of shipping industry has to go through rough sea in coming years to reach a safe destination.
The cape index is down nearly 8.56 percent over the past one week and closed at 630 points on 13 Friday 2015. The Panamax index was the only segment where the index was up 16.04 pct week over week and closed 499 points. The Supramax and Handy size index was also down and closed at 436 points (down by 17.73 pct) and 268 points (down by 10.96 pct) respectively on 13 Friday.
In the Far East/SE Asia the freight rates continued its decline this week and the Supramax charter rate delivery arrival load ports in Kalimantan were being rated at around $ 6,500 per day. In the meantime, Panamax charter rates were soft and ships were reported fixed delivery Indonesia around $ 4,000 per day for a trip to India below its break-even point. Freight rates are still expected to be weak on Supramax and Panamax in coming days.
The Cape average charter rates were reported at around $ 5,117 per day, far below its break-even point, Panamax is at around $ 3,984 per day , Supramax at $ 5,077 per day and Handy size/$ 4,021 per day.
The futures for three years (2015-2017) was reported at around $ 14,000 per day for Cape, $ 9,000 per day for Panamax, $ 9,000 per day for Supramax and Handy size at $ 7,500 per day.
The route S8 route for Supramax was declines 10.20% closing at $ 4,625 per day (last week $ 5094 per day). Freight rates from Indonesia to India is expected remain weak next week.
The Brent crude oil prices was up by 7.43 pct closing at $ 61.52 per barrel (last week $ 57.80 per barrel). The bunker prices was almost at same levels closing at 366.00 pmt (IFO 380 cst ex Singapore on 13th Feb 2015).
Baltic Dry Index (BDI) - DOWN
Cape index (BCI) - DOWN
Panamax index (BPI) - UP
Supramax index (BSI) - DOWN
Handy index - DOWN
(as of week ended 13 February 2015 (week on week changes))
